Airports in Mexico City

Mexico City Benito Juarez International Airport (MEX)

  • The distance from Mexico City Benito Juarez International Airport (MEX) to central Mexico City is roughly 13 kilometres. It takes around 30 minutes to reach the centre driving.

  • It takes around 40 minutes when travelling by public transport.

Mexico City Felipe Angeles International Airport (NLU)

  • Central Mexico City is about 56 kilometres from Mexico City Felipe Angeles International Airport (NLU). Once your flight from Miami International Airport to Mexico City has touched down and you've made your way out of the airport, the drive should take about 55 minutes.

  • If you're travelling on public transport, it'll take around 2 hours.
